> On 3/18/2016 10:59 AM, Don H via Talk wrote:
>> Running WE 9.4 on a Windows 10 64 bit machine on a HP laptop.
>> I have it set up to go into sleep mode when the lid is closed.  With WE
>> 9.3 and now 9.4 WE is silent when opening the lid thus returning from
>> sleep mode.  I reported this issue with WE 9.3 and now with 9.4 and got
>> no response from the support team.  Guess it isn't high on the list of
>> things to fix with WE 9.3 as it still exists with 9.4.  Sometimes you
>> can close the lid and open it again and WE starts and sometimes it
>> won't.  Can use control alt w to restart WE however was told by the WE
>> staff that this still leaves WE in something less than normal mode.
